Yamal Nuclear Icebreaker Service Period Extended

  • Rosatomflot, the operator of Russia’s nuclear icebreaker fleet, has extended the recourse of the nuclear unit of its ‘Yamal’ icebreaker from 150,000 hours to 200,000 hours, thus increasing the vessel’s service period by 6 years till 2028.

    This is the second time the service period of “Yamal” has been extended. Previously, its resource was extended up to 150,000 hours. As of July 1, 2020, the 1992-buil nuclear icebreaker was in service for 149,500 hours.
